Here are the roles we will cover, presented in a 3D pie chart that highlights their percentage distribution in the job market: 1. **3D Printing Engineer**: These professionals are responsible for designing, developing, and optimizing 3D printing systems, including temperature-controlled equipment. They typically have a background in mechanical, electrical, or software engineering. 2. **Temperature-Controlled Equipment Specialist**: Specialists in temperature-controlled equipment ensure the reliable operation and maintenance of advanced 3D printers that require precise temperature control. They may have experience in HVAC, mechatronics, or related fields. 3. **Additive Manufacturing Technician**: Technicians in additive manufacturing focus on operating and maintaining 3D printers, post-processing printed parts, and ensuring consistent quality. They often have hands-on experience with various 3D printing technologies. 4. **Quality Control Inspector**: Professionals in this role are responsible for inspecting and testing 3D printed parts, ensuring they meet the required specifications and quality standards. They may have experience in metrology, materials science, or related fields. 5. **Material Scientist**: Material scientists specialize in the research, development, and characterization of materials used in 3D printing, including temperature-controlled systems. They typically have a strong background in chemistry, physics, or materials science.
